Step-free access category B1. Step-free access to Ryde bound platform. Ramped walking route, c. 130m to get to Shanklin bound platform. A step-free path is provided between the station entrance and platform 2 (trains towards Sandown, Lake and Shanklin) which requires users to cross the line via a railway crossing.
